How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chapel Creek?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Chapel Creek Studio Apartments | $1,530 | $1,100 | $2,981 |
Chapel Creek 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,768 | $1,139 | $4,637 |
Chapel Creek 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,560 | $1,382 | $10,000+ |
Chapel Creek 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,293 | $1,584 | $10,000+ |
Chapel Creek 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,510 | $4,510 | $4,510 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Chapel Creek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Chapel Creek with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Chapel Creek is at Stonebrook Village listed at $1,382.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Chapel Creek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Chapel Creek is $2,560.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Chapel Creek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Chapel Creek is a 2,372 square feet unit starting from $14,906 at The Monarch HALL Park.
What is the average size for Chapel Creek 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Chapel Creek is currently 1,480 sq ft.
